The Itinerary: A Detailed Look
Our journey begins at 09:00 sharp, meeting at the pier next to the gas station in Zadar. This straightforward meeting point means you won’t waste time navigating tricky pick-up spots, a plus for travelers on a tight schedule. After a quick introduction, the real fun starts with the skipper explaining sailing theory step-by-step. This educational component makes the trip not just fun but also enriching for those curious about how sailing works.
By around 09:30, the boat sets sail from the marina, pushing off into the Zadar Channel. Here, you’ll find yourself on a Justin Ten regatta boat, a vessel designed for speed and agility. The boat’s sporty nature means you’ll get to see what racing sailors experience, but don’t worry—there’s a good balance of instruction and hands-on participation.
The sailing itself is invigorating. We loved the way the skipper encouraged everyone to take part in operating the vessel, offering tips and tricks along the way. Multiple reviews mention the clear, concise guidance: “You get the theory first, then practice it,” which ensures even complete beginners feel confident by the end.
Around mid-morning, the first of many swimming breaks occurs. The chosen spots are usually picturesque, with calm waters perfect for revitalizing dips. These breaks are often at charming local spots or secluded bays, allowing plenty of time to relax, take photos, and enjoy the seascape. Expect to snorkel with the provided gear and perhaps try fishing if you’re feeling lucky.
As the day progresses, the boat continues along the coast, exploring small villages and scenic coves. The ability to capture stunning coastal images is a bonus, especially as the boat maneuvers past rugged cliffs and vibrant marinas. The Skipper’s local knowledge helps spot hidden gems that aren’t in typical guidebooks.
Returning to Zadar around 17:00, you’ll have experienced a full day of sailing, swimming, and learning—an active, memorable day that’s both fun and educational.
The Included and Not Included
The price of $62 per person covers most essentials, including the skipper, fishing and snorkeling equipment, and the fuel and port fees. This makes it a very reasonable option for the value-packed experience of a full day on the water. However, food and drinks are not included, so consider bringing snacks, water, or perhaps planning a meal afterward at one of Zadar’s many seaside restaurants.
Practical Details and Tips
The tour begins at 09:00, so arriving on time is key. Be sure to bring swimwear, a towel, sunscreen, and beachwear—the Croatian sun can be quite fierce, especially during summer months. Dress comfortably and be prepared to get a little wet, as swimming breaks are a core part of the experience.
Since the tour is conducted in Croatian and English, language shouldn’t be a barrier. The activity isn’t suitable for those with mobility impairments, so plan accordingly if needed.
Booking is flexible—you can reserve now and pay later, giving peace of mind in uncertain travel times. Just remember, cancellations are accepted up to 24 hours in advance for a full refund.

FAQ
Is this tour suitable for beginners?
Yes, the tour provides step-by-step instruction on sailing theory and practical skills, making it perfect for beginners eager to learn.
What should I bring?
Bring swimwear, a towel, sunscreen, and beachwear. It’s also good to have some snacks or drinks, as food and drinks are not included.
How long does the tour last?
The full experience runs from 09:00 to around 17:00, giving you a full day of sailing, swimming, and exploration.
Are snorkeling and fishing equipment included?
Yes, snorkeling and fishing gear are provided, so you can enjoy water activities during the breaks.
Can I cancel the booking?
Yes, you can cancel up to 24 hours in advance for a full refund, offering flexibility if your plans change.
Is the tour suitable for children?
Children comfortable in the water and with an adventurous spirit will enjoy the experience, but check with the provider if you have specific concerns.
What language is the tour conducted in?
The tour is offered in Croatian and English, making it accessible for most travelers.
What is the group size?
While not specified, small groups are typical for such tours, ensuring personal guidance.
Is transportation provided?
No, you meet directly at the pier next to the gas station in Zadar; transportation to the meeting point is your responsibility.
What if the weather is bad?
Weather conditions might affect the tour, but the provider allows for cancellations up to 24 hours in advance, giving you flexibility.
